What is the scope of Six Sigma?

Precisely, the term 'Six Sigma' refers to the capability to produce strictly within well-defined specifications. Six Sigma deployment helps the industries to get the defect level below 3.4 DPMO (defects per million opportunities), which is a benchmark for any Six Sigma oriented industry.Jun 28, 2017

What Sipoc means?

A SIPOC (suppliers, inputs, process, outputs, customers) diagram is a visual tool for documenting a business process from beginning to end prior to implementation.

When did Six Sigma start?

History of Six Sigma. Here, are important landmark form the Six Sigma history: In, 1970-Motorola started experimenting with problem-solving using statistical analysis. In 1986, Bill Smith a senior scientist working in Motorola introduced the concept of six sigma to standardize the way defects are counted.

What is the purpose of six sigma?

The name Six Sigma has its origins in a statistical method of modeling a manufacturing process that is as free as possible of errors or defects . In statistics, six sigma indicates a likelihood of 3.4 defects per million things produced.

What is Six Sigma?

Six Sigma is a set of quality management techniques and tools that have been widely adopted by American corporations. Six Sigma originated as a method of minimizing errors or defects in manufacturing processes. It has since had a pervasive influence on management practices in the U.S. and abroad.

Who developed Six Sigma?

Six Sigma is a set of quality management techniques and tools developed in the 1980s and adopted by American corporations, including General Electric. 1  Development of the Six Sigma system is credited to Bill Smith, a Motorola engineer, and the name was trademarked by Motorola in 1993. What does the Greek letter Sigma mean?

The lowercase Greek letter sigma, σ, represents the standard deviation or amount of variability. “Every process that produces something, whether you’re baking a cake or making a product in a factory, is going to have some level of variation,” Hayes said. “Six Sigma is an attempt to analyze the process, figure out where the variation, error, waste, or defect is coming from, and then eventually minimize or eliminate it.”

What is a black belt in Six Sigma?

Six Sigma Black Belt – Black Belts “are the doers, the technical leaders and change agents in an organization," per ASQ ( ASQ PDF source ). They are project leaders who also coach and mentor Green Belts.

What is a Six Sigma Green Belt?

Six Sigma Green Belt – These individuals “serve on project teams to help collect and analyze data, develop process maps, assist the Black Belt in some levels of statistical analysis, and even develop experimental designs for a particular project,” according to ASQ.
